Comprehensive Rule Set

Mastering EuropeTransit requires not only strategic acumen but also a thorough understanding of its rules:

  • Objective: Players aim to create the most comprehensive and efficient transit network across Europe. Points are awarded based on the number of cities connected and the speed and efficiency of transport routes.
  • Turn Structure: Gameplay unfolds in turns, each representing a quarter of a year. Within a turn, players can undertake expansions, make repairs, and schedule maintenance for their transit networks.
  • Resource Management: Starting with a limited budget, players earn income based on route efficiency which can be reinvested into upgrades and expansions. Wise allocation of funds is crucial to victory.
  • Event Cards: Drawing from a deck of event cards at the start of each turn introduces unpredictability. These cards reflect real-time events and can either positively or negatively impact player progress.
  • Transportation Modes: Choices include rail, air, and road networks, each with its strengths and limitations. Players must decide which modes are best suited for different regions and scenarios.
